Output 63fab4a3842d8efb3990f06697f365d11f416c25987b94d55d19f81a2cbb0e6a:1

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adff0901befc039a6c3b4626cb6bdb7635e4f2fb OP_EQUAL
address
3HZ2LtKLjns5p3e2W2BncoBveShU9cDaxH
transaction
63fab4a3842d8efb3990f06697f365d11f416c25987b94d55d19f81a2cbb0e6a
spent
true